Frequently asked questions
Expect €130-€350 per night for a discreet suite with a private hot tub. Tariffs climb to €400-€600 for villas with spa, sauna or private pool. Love in Room never adds a commission: the price you see is the host's price.
Private hot tub tops the list (searched 6,600 times a month in France). Then comes a private spa (sauna or hammam), bioethanol fireplace, starry ceiling, and for the bolder, an equipped sex room. Each page lets you filter by amenity.
For weekends from March to October, count 3-6 weeks ahead for premium cities (Annecy, Deauville, Saint-Malo, Provence). Weekday stays remain available 48 h ahead. Booking happens directly with the host.
A love room is private by design: no shared corridor, no breakfast hall, no front desk. It's a bubble for two. A romantic hotel stays collective, the décor may be charming, but the experience remains public.
Annecy for its lake-mountain combo, Deauville and Saint-Malo for off-season seaside, Aix-en-Provence and Avignon for the southern light, Paris and Lyon for urban chic. Each city has its signature, pick the décor.
